Meraas unveils final phase of Dubai standalone villa community
Meraas, a member of Dubai Holding Real Estate (DHRE), has announced the launch of the final phase of The Acres, its exclusive standalone villa community, centrally located in Dubailand.
Featuring 106 villas and 102 mansions, the final phase offers a blend of well-being, nature and elevated lifestyle amenities with a mix of three-, four- and five-bedroom villas, alongside The Acres Estates, featuring the exquisite Amber and Ivory Collections with five-, six- and seven-bedroom mansions.
Each residence embodies a distinct architectural style while upholding the highest standards of luxury, sustainability, and refined living, said the developer.
According to Meraas, The Acres is designed with sustainability weaved into every aspect of its architecture and the community is committed to an 80% reduction in greenhouse gas emissions per capita compared to the national average.
It utilises 33% less water than the UAE average, with 100% of irrigation demand covered by treated wastewater. The project incorporates water-saving fixtures, efficient irrigation systems, and low-water plants, it stated.
The community was awarded the Leed Gold for Communities pre-certification, a unique aspect of the LEED programme, underscoring Meraas' commitment to building environmentally responsible communities from the ground up and to international standards, with sustainability at the heart of its operations.
This prestigious pre-certification, a first for Meraas, was awarded by Green Business Certification Inc. (GBCI), the administrative body responsible for verifying LEED and other green certification schemes, it added.
On the launch, Khalid Al Malik, the CEO of Dubai Holding Real Estate, said its reflects the group's commitment to creating sustainable communities that promote well-being and a strong connection with nature, values that are increasingly important to today's homeowners.
"With evolving consumer preferences prioritising eco-conscious living, wellness-focused design, and thoughtfully integrated spaces, The Acres is designed to meet these changing needs. Achieving Leed Gold pre-certification further underscores our dedication to environmental responsibility and global best practices, ensuring a future-focused lifestyle for our residents," he noted.
The Acres Estates range in plot size from 9,000 to 17,700 sq. ft. across both the Amber and Ivory Collections, with private gardens that are directly connected to the safe pedestrian pathways full of greenery that lead to the park and lagoon.
The Amber Collection exudes a contemporary aesthetic with clean lines and natural materials, while the Ivory Collection presents a more traditional design with vertical stone-clad walls and minimalist white horizontal lines, he explained.
These villas, he stated, feature a seamless blend of indoor and outdoor living spaces, centrally located kitchens with easy access to dining and lounge areas, grand master bedroom suites with private terraces and walk-in closets, spacious bathrooms with views of the surrounding landscape, and unique courtyard designs maximising natural light and privacy.
According to him, the residents will benefit from an abundance of green spaces, (2.5 times more than the global average), with every villa a mere three-minute walk from a park.
"The community is also thoughtfully designed to feature a strong social infrastructure including the Halo Loop Park, a nursery, school, clinic, mosques, clubhouses, retail area, and an Edible Garden. Active lifestyle amenities include a trail network, outdoor gym, playgrounds, swimming pools, and sports areas," he added. -TradeArabia News Service

KEO expands Sustainability + Environment Division with acquisition of Meehan Green
Industry News KEO expands Sustainability + Environment Division with acquisition of Meehan Green By The combined teams will immediately collaborate on active projects in Ireland, Europe, and Middle East, with plans to scale operations in Ireland and Europe KEO International Consultants has announced the acquisition of Meehan Green, which is said to be one of Europe's leading green building consultancies. The acquisition significantly expands KEO's Sustainability + Environment Division, which is the largest in the Middle East and one of the largest waste management consultancies globally, the firm said in a statement. The acquisition also accelerates KEO's expansion into Europe and reinforces its commitment to providing innovative ESG, decarbonisation, and green building solutions worldwide. 'We are pleased to welcome Meehan Green to KEO. Their specialised expertise and strong reputation in Ireland and throughout Europe add important capabilities to our Sustainability + Environment Division. This partnership allows us to better serve our clients pursuing ambitious green building standards in Europe and beyond, while staying true to our shared commitment and passion to practical, innovative solutions,' said Donna Sultan, President and CEO of KEO. Following the acquisition, Meehan Green will operate as Meehan Green, a KEO Company, and will combine its deep regional expertise with KEO's global scale, innovation, and sustainability capabilities. Nellie Reid, LEED Fellow, Managing Director of Meehan Green added, 'This is an exciting next step for our business. Joining KEO empowers us to elevate our legacy of sustainability leadership in Ireland and beyond. By uniting our local insights with KEO's global reach, we can deliver transformative results for clients bridging policy, innovation, and execution to meet the urgent demands of a decarbonising world.' KEO's Sustainability + Environment Division, led by Christian Millar, is renowned for its multidisciplinary approach. Its team of engineers, biologists, scientists, architects, and policymakers are pioneers of green progress, fueled by continuous research and a passion for innovative solutions. By pushing sustainability boundaries, KEO delivers solutions that not only exceed benchmarks, but also drive meaningful change for communities and the planet. With the addition of Meehan Green's specialised team, KEO further solidifies its position as the partner of choice for organizations navigating complex sustainability, ESG, and Net Zero challenges, the statement from KEO explained. Millar continued, 'Meehan Green's proven track record in high-performance, green building certifications and whole building lifecycle carbon analysis aligns seamlessly with our vision. This acquisition isn't just about growth. It's about amplifying our collective ability to turn sustainability ambitions into measurable outcomes. Clients across Europe and the Middle East will now have access to an even deeper reservoir of expertise.' The combined teams will collaborate on active projects in Ireland, Europe, and the Middle East, with plans to scale operations in Ireland and Europe to meet rising demand. KEO's investment in Meehan Green underscores its long-term strategy towards global sustainability transition through innovation, talent, and geographic diversification, the firm said.

Meraas unveils 754-unit Jumeirah residential towers project
UAE - Meraas, a member of Dubai Holding Real Estate, has announced the launch of Jumeirah Residences Emirates Towers, a bold new addition to the city's iconic skyline. Designed by acclaimed SCDA Architects, the development introduces a distinctive cantilevered architectural form that sets a new standard for sophisticated urban living. It boasts 754 branded residences - ranging from one-to-four-bedroom layouts - set across two distinctive towers. It offers views of the Museum of the Future and Downtown Dubai, with each residence crafted to ensure complete privacy, said the statement from Meraas. A private entrance beneath the striking cantilever leads to a grand double-height lobby, serene garden courtyard and lounge, establishing an immediate sense of refined luxury, it added. Meraas said the development's three exclusive sky terraces feature infinity-edge pools, landscaped lounges and open-air entertainment spaces, enhancing the towers' allure. Interiors showcase a palette of natural materials, including marble and wood, designed to reflect timeless elegance and elevated design, it stated. According to Meraas, residents will enjoy access to a comprehensive range of lifestyle and wellness amenities, including a state-of-the-art fitness centre with dedicated studios, an executive co-working lounge, a private cinema, a resort-style family pool, padel courts, a children's play zone and well-curated social and dining venues. Dubai Holding Real Estate CEO Khalid Al Malik said: "Jumeirah Residences Emirates Towers represents the evolution of Dubai's luxury living landscape, where world-class design meets unparalleled hospitality." "By integrating Jumeirah's legendary service standards with innovative architectural design, we are setting new benchmarks for premium residential offerings that reflect Dubai's position as a global destination of choice," he noted. "This project reaffirms Meraas' dedication to creating contemporary spaces that perfectly balance purposeful living with sophisticated comfort," he added. Al Malik said all residents will benefit from Jumeirah's luxury hospitality services, including access to bespoke wellness treatments, personal fitness coaching, 24-hour concierge services and vehicle management. Residents will also get to enjoy access to private chefs for exceptional dining experiences, supported by a dedicated team to deliver seamlessly executed events, he added. Jumeirah CEO Thomas B. Meier said: "Jumeirah Residences Emirates Towers marks the next chapter in our growth journey, showcasing the future of the Jumeirah brand through intentional design, mindful living and holistic wellbeing." "With a growing focus on branded residences designed to elevate and inspire living well every day, this development reinforces our leadership in luxury hospitality, rooted in the spirit of Arabian hospitality," he added.
